单片机原理及接口技术试卷3答案.doc

单片机原理及接口技术试卷3答案.doc

ID:48209905

大小:1.02 MB

页数:6页

时间:2019-11-16

单片机原理及接口技术试卷3答案.doc_第1页
单片机原理及接口技术试卷3答案.doc_第2页
单片机原理及接口技术试卷3答案.doc_第3页
单片机原理及接口技术试卷3答案.doc_第4页
单片机原理及接口技术试卷3答案.doc_第5页
资源描述:

《单片机原理及接口技术试卷3答案.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、《单片机原理及接口技术》试卷3班级:姓名:学号:成绩:一、填空题(20分,评分标准:每小题各2)1、十进制数-29的8位补码表示为11100011B。2、MCS-51有7种寻址方式,特殊功能寄存器只能采用直接寻址方式。3、MCS-51串行接口有4种工作方式,这可在初始化程序中用软件填写特殊功能寄存器SCON加以选择。4、MCS-51有5个中断源,有2个中断优先级,优先级由软件填写特殊功能寄存器IP加以选择。5、假定(A)=56H,(R5)=67H。执行指令:ADDA,R5DAA后,累加器A的内容为23H,CY的内容为1。6、假定标

2、号qaz的地址为0100H,标号qwe值为0123H(即跳转的目标地址为0123H)。执行指令:qaz:SJMPqwe该指令的相对偏移量为0123H-0102H=21H。7、MCS-51单片机访问片外存储器时,利用ALE信号锁存来自P0口的低8位地址信号。8、MCS-51单片机片内RAM的工作寄存器区共有32个单元,分为4组寄存器,每组8个单元,以R0~R7作为寄存器名。9、MCS-51单片机中P0口作地址/数据总线,传送地址码的低8位;P2口作地址总线,传送地址码的高8位。二、选择题(20分,评分标准:每小题各2分)1、在中断服

3、务程序中,至少应有一条(D)(A)传送指令(B)转移指令(C)加法指令(D)中断返回指令2、ORG2000HLCALL3000H0RG3000HRET左边程序执行完RET指令后,PC=(C)(A)2000H(B)3000H(C)2003H(D)3003H3、要使MCS-51能够响应定时器T1中断、串行接口中断,它的中断允许寄存器IE的内容应是(A)(A)98H(B)84H(C)42H(D)22H4、若某存储器芯片地址线为12根,那么它的存储容量为(C)(A)1KB(B)2KB(C)4KB(D)8KB5、下面哪种外设是输出设备(A)

4、(A)打印机(B)纸带读出机(C)键盘(D)A/D转换器6、下面哪一个部件不是CPU的指令部件(C)(A)PC(B)IR(C)PSW(D)ID7、以下运算中对溢出标志OV没有影响或不受OV影响的运算是(A)(A)逻辑运算(B)符号数加减法运算(C)乘法运算(D)除法运算8、以下指令中,属于单纯读引脚的指令是(C)(A)MOVP1,A(B)ORLP1,#0FH(C)MOVC,P1.5(D)DJNZP1,short-lable9、在异步通讯接口,其帧格式由1个起始位(0)、7个数据位、1个偶校验和1个停止位“1”组成。当该接口每分钟传

5、送1800个字符时,传送波特率为(D)(A)1800b/s(B)10b/s(C)3000b/s(D)300b/s10、各中断源发出的中断请求信号,都会标记在MCS-51系统的(B)(A)TMOD(B)TCON/SCON(C)IE(D)IP三、判断题(10分,评分标准:每小题各1分)1、MCS-51的程序存储器只是用来存放程序的。(×)2、当MCS-51上电复位时,堆栈指针(SP)=00H。(×)3、判断以下指令段的正误。(×)MOVP2,#30HMOVR2,#57HMOVXA,@R24、0070H80FEHERE:SJMPHERE

6、执行该指令后,程序将原地踏步。(√)5、51单片机内部有两片寄存器,既是工作寄存器和专用寄存器,因在同片内RAM,则它们是统一编址。(√)6、要进行多机通讯,MCS-51串行接口的工作方式应选方式1。(×)7、定时器工作于方式2,若GATE=1、TR0=1、INT0=1就可启动定时/计数器。(√)8、使用89C51且/EA=1时,仍可外扩64KB的程序存储器。(×)9、MCS-51的相对转移指令最大负跳距是127B。(×)10、PC存放的是当前正在执行的指令。(×)四、简答分析编程题(任选3题,30分,评分标准:每小题各10分)1

7、、89C51单片机片内设有几个定时器/计数器?它们是由哪些SFR组成?定时器/计数器作定时和计数时,其计数脉冲分别由谁提供?答:89C51单片机片内设有2个定时器/计数器:定时器/计数器0和定时器/计数器1。由TH0、TL0、TH1、TL1、TMOD、TCON特殊功能寄存器组成。作定时器时,计数脉冲来自单片机内部,其频率为振荡频率的1/12;作计数器时,计数脉冲来自单片机外部,通过引脚T0(P3.4)和T1(P3.5)对外部脉冲信号计数,当输入脉冲信号从1到0的负跳变时,计数器就自动加1。计数的最高频率一般为振荡频率的1/24。2

8、、简述89C51单片机的中断响应过程。答:单片机如查询到某个中断标志为1,将按优先级进行中断处理。中断得到响应后,对于有些中断源,CPU在响应中断后会自动清除中断标志,由硬件将程序计数器PC内容压入堆栈保护,然后将对应的中断矢量装入程序计数器PC,

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。